WideSide® Sonar
(with optional-purchase WideSide® transducer)
Your 700 Series™ Fishing System also
supports WideSide® sonar with the
purchase of an additional WideSide®
transducer. The WideSide® transducer is a
specialized "side-looking" transducer that is
extremely useful for bank fishing or looking
for bait fish in open water. The WideSide®
transducer uses three different sonar
elements that transmit signals to the left,
right and straight down from your boat. The
downward beam is 200 kHz with a 24° area
of coverage. This beam maintains a
continuous digital depth readout from the
bottom directly beneath your boat. The side
beams are 455 kHz with a 16° area of
coverage. The side-looking elements can be
used independently, or together to locate
targets near the surface of the water on
either side of your boat.
